Mortal Kombat 11

There’s no spine so nice it couldn’t stand to be ripped out and played like a bloody mandolin. Mortal Kombat 11 is the latest game to bless you with the gruesome powers of non-consensual organ extraction. Play with your friends and quickly discover who’s had the power to de-limb a muscular adult inside them all along. Long-time fans will appreciate the numerous callbacks, while new acolytes of the Mortal Kombat world will surely appreciate the gleeful, unhinged brutality on constant display. It’s like a regular fighting game without any troublesome nonsense like restraint or tact. Leave your inhibitions at home, kids. They’ve no purchase here.

Control

As a government employee, I can say with come certainty that no actual federal gig will ever be as cool or weird as this one. Control is the perfect way to live out your paranormal state secret daydreams, without any of the mind-numbing paperwork. Although your coworkers’ weird ramblings are still quite bad for your health, here you can eradicate their corrupted butts with a shape-shifting psychic firearm! Anyone in your life convinced their job is the absolute worst would do well to experience some perspective with this, the most punishing of office jobs in existence.

2D Castlevania games are cool AF, and Bloodstained is made by one of their progenitors. At the very least, Igarashi made the game that birthed the term ‘MetroidVania.’ If you have anyone in your life who’s racked up a ton of hours tracking and backtracking through a massive world with an ever-expanding power set, they will slurp up this game like four-star ramen. As a long-time MetroidVania devotee, I can attest to this fact. Bloodstained is that wholesome blend of compelling and confounding that will keep you hooked until the very end, or even longer if one of those completionists. A perfect gift for all the backtrackers in your life.

Indivisible

Indivisible

This one was cooking for a good while before we got the finished product, and it looks like it was super worth it. Hand-drawn graphics, complex combat, a rich narrative, and a proper challenge await you. Or in this case, the gamer in your life who gets down with beautiful turn-based (but also action) RPGs. Indivisible wears many hats, but the most prominent one is that of a strategy game. Fast reflexes and exploration aside, this one is all about choosing moves with due care and concern. Otherwise, you’re doomed? If this feels up the alley of anyone in your life, don’t hesitate to take the plunge.

PS Plus

playstation plus

Every PS4 owner should have a PlayStation Plus membership. Whether to play with their friends, earn greater discounts on games, or simply get anywhere from 2 to 6 free games a month, a PS Plus account is an essential part of the PlayStation experience. With cards such as the 3 Month or 12 Month Subscription cards, PlayStation Plus can be a full gift or a stocking stuffer.
